When the first shoe drops
Rinoa’s POV
I couldn’t wait to get home to Squally; I spent all week in Timber trying to help out Zone and Watts. Galbadia soldiers were all over the place and it was hard to get anything done. All I could think about was coming home. Angelo follows me down the hall, his tongue hanging out; he misses my Squally bear too. I’m glad that Quitis is off on some mission, I wouldn’t want her sinking her claws into him while I’m gone. He’s my knight; jus because they grew up together and she has a little power doesn’t mean she can take him from me. I pass Zone and go straight to my room. I wonder what Squally’s thinking. I open the junction to our link. He always says not to use it but what harm can it do. Squally~ what are you thinking?
What am I going to do? I wonder if Rinoa knows yet. What the hell am I supposed to do with this...? I wonder how Irvine is doing.
Irvine? Why isn’t he thinking about how I’m doing? What’s so special about him?
Zone opens the door without knocking, he’s lucky I didn’t hit him with a fire bolt. Angelo runs up and starts molesting his leg.
“Tee Hee! I think he missed you!” He blushes and tries to shake him off.
“Hey Princess.” Watts says strolling in with a grin. It’s always nice to come and visit the forest owls. The guys in Balamb don’t pay this much attention to me because I’m the commander’s girl, so when I come home it’s nice to be appreciated. He frowns a little. “Have you heard the news?”
“What news?” I ask pouting at the fact that they know something I don’t. “Is it about Squally?” Zone frowns, and Watts shakes his head. “Then what?”
“It’s your father.”
